@fokin_nikolay1989

Как вывести ключ лицензии?

Есть вот такой вариант
/opt/cprocsp/sbin/amd64/cpconfig -license -view | awk '{print $1}' | tail -n

но он мне выводит 2 строки
mnt]# /opt/cprocsp/sbin/amd64/cpconfig -license -view | awk '{print $1}' | tail -n2
XXXXX-YYYYY-AAAAA-ZZZZZ-FFFFF
license
А как вывести что бы был только ключ?
  • Вопрос задан
  • 308 просмотров
Решения вопроса 2
saboteur_kiev
@saboteur_kiev Куратор тега Linux
software engineer
/opt/cprocsp/sbin/amd64/cpconfig -license -view | awk '{print $1}' | tail -n 2 | head -n 1
Ответ написан
Комментировать
romy4
@romy4
Exception handler
добавьте | head -n1
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
@Swartalf
А почему бы не через регуляку в grep?
что то вроде
/opt/cprocsp/sbin/amd64/cpconfig -license -view | grep -Eo '[A-X]{5,5}-[A-X]{5,5}-[A-X]{5,5}-[A-X]{5,5}-[A-X]{5,5}'
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ы